    Brief

    Dublin City Council (DCC) is seeking qualified support service providers to maintain and support its existing Sydney Coordinated Adaptive Traffic System (SCATS) installation. This single-party framework agreement covers comprehensive maintenance and support services through the official SCATS partner network. Key Service Requirements: • Remote troubleshooting and technical support • SCATS software upgrade assistance and troubleshooting • On-site support visits when needed • Defined emergency response times • Software patching and version upgrades • Documentation updates and maintenance Contract Details: • Initial contract term: 12 months • Optional extensions: 2-5 years (subject to satisfactory performance, business need, and budget availability) • Project is subject to funding approval Prospective suppliers should be certified SCATS support partners with proven experience in maintaining traffic management systems.
